CLASS aia net/minecraft/entity/Entity FIELD A velocityModified Z FIELD B movementMultiplier Lcrl; FIELD C removed Z FIELD G fallDistance F FIELD H prevRenderX D FIELD I prevRenderY D FIELD J prevRenderZ D FIELD K stepHeight F FIELD L noClip Z FIELD M pushSpeedReduction F FIELD N random Ljava/util/Random; FIELD O age I FIELD P insideWater Z FIELD U dataTracker Lqk; FIELD V FLAGS Lqh; FIELD W POSE Lqh; FIELD Y chunkX I FIELD Z chunkY I FIELD aA SILENT Lqh; FIELD aB NO_GRAVITY Lqh; FIELD aC invulnerable Z FIELD aD scoreboardTags Ljava/util/Set; FIELD aF pistonMovementDelta [D FIELD aG pistonMovementTick J FIELD aH size Laib; FIELD aI standingEyeHeight F FIELD aa chunkZ I FIELD ae ignoreCameraFrustum Z FIELD af velocityDirty Z FIELD ag portalCooldown I FIELD ah inPortal Z FIELD ai portalTime I FIELD aj dimension Lbxt; FIELD ak lastPortalPosition Lev; FIELD an uuid Ljava/util/UUID; FIELD ao uuidString Ljava/lang/String; FIELD ap glowing Z FIELD aq passengerList Ljava/util/List; FIELD ar riddenEntity Laia; FIELD as velocity Lcrl; FIELD at boundingBox Lcrg; FIELD aw fireTime I FIELD ax BREATH Lqh; FIELD ay CUSTOM_NAME Lqh; FIELD az NAME_VISIBLE Lqh; FIELD b MAX_ENTITY_ID Ljava/util/concurrent/atomic/AtomicInteger; FIELD c EMPTY_STACK_LIST Ljava/util/List; FIELD d NULL_BOX Lcrg; FIELD e renderDistanceMultiplier D FIELD f type Laie; FIELD g entityId I FIELD h LOGGER Lorg/apache/logging/log4j/Logger; FIELD j ridingCooldown I FIELD k teleporting Z FIELD l world Lbgx; FIELD m prevX D FIELD n prevY D FIELD o prevZ D FIELD p x D FIELD q y D FIELD r z D FIELD s yaw F FIELD t pitch F FIELD u prevYaw F FIELD v prevPitch F FIELD w onGround Z FIELD x horizontalCollision Z FIELD y verticalCollision Z FIELD z collided Z METHOD (Laie;Lbgx;)V ARG 1 type ARG 2 world METHOD E updatePortalCooldown ()V METHOD N createSpawnPacket ()Lka; METHOD R detach ()V METHOD S getType ()Laie; METHOD T getEntityId ()I METHOD U getScoreboardTags ()Ljava/util/Set; METHOD V kill ()V METHOD W getDataTracker ()Lqk; METHOD Y remove ()V METHOD Z getPose ()Lait; METHOD a handleStatus (B)V ARG 1 status METHOD a shouldRenderAtDistance (D)Z ARG 1 distance METHOD a requestTeleport (DDD)V METHOD a setPositionAnglesAndUpdate (DDDFF)V ARG 1 x ARG 3 y ARG 5 z ARG 7 yaw ARG 8 pitch METHOD a setPositionAndRotations (DDDFFIZ)V ARG 1 x ARG 3 y ARG 5 z METHOD a rayTrace (DFZ)Lcrj; ARG 1 maxDistance ARG 3 tickDelta METHOD a fall (DZLbuz;Lev;)V ARG 1 heightDifference ARG 3 onGround ARG 4 blockState ARG 5 blockPos METHOD a setRotation (FF)V ARG 1 yaw METHOD a updateVelocity (FLcrl;)V ARG 1 speed ARG 2 movementInput METHOD a damage (Lahj;F)Z ARG 1 source ARG 2 amount METHOD a startRiding (Laia;Z)Z ARG 1 entity METHOD a setEquippedStack (Laif;Lbbr;)V ARG 1 slot METHOD a dealDamage (Laij;Laia;)V ARG 1 attacker ARG 2 target METHOD a move (Laio;Lcrl;)V ARG 1 type ARG 2 offset METHOD a getSize (Lait;)Laib; METHOD a getEyeHeight (Lait;Laib;)F METHOD a onStruckByLightning (Latc;)V ARG 1 lightning METHOD a interactAt (Lavo;Lcrl;Lagu;)Lagv; ARG 1 player ARG 2 hitPos METHOD a dropStack (Lbbr;)Latf; METHOD a dropStack (Lbbr;F)Latf; ARG 1 stack METHOD a canExplosionDestroyBlock (Lbgq;Lbgi;Lev;Lbuz;F)Z ARG 1 explosion ARG 2 world ARG 3 pos ARG 4 state METHOD a getEffectiveExplosionResistance (Lbgq;Lbgi;Lev;Lbuz;Lckp;F)F ARG 1 explosion ARG 2 world ARG 3 pos ARG 5 state METHOD a dropItem (Lbgw;)Latf; METHOD a dropItem (Lbgw;I)Latf; METHOD a setWorld (Lbgx;)V METHOD a applyMirror (Lbpm;)F METHOD a applyRotation (Lbqm;)F METHOD a onBlockCollision (Lbuz;)V METHOD a slowMovement (Lbuz;Lcrl;)V ARG 1 state ARG 2 multipliers METHOD a changeDimension (Lbxt;)Laia; METHOD a lookAt (Lck$a;Lcrl;)V ARG 1 anchor ARG 2 target METHOD a setBoundingBox (Lcrg;)V METHOD a movementInputToVelocity (Lcrl;FF)Lcrl; ARG 0 movementInput ARG 1 speed ARG 2 yaw METHOD a clipSneakingMovement (Lcrl;Laio;)Lcrl; ARG 1 offset ARG 2 type METHOD a isTeamPlayer (Lcsn;)Z METHOD a populateCrashReport (Le;)V METHOD a setPositionAndAngles (Lev;FF)V ARG 1 pos ARG 2 yaw ARG 3 pitch METHOD a playStepSound (Lev;Lbuz;)V ARG 1 pos ARG 2 state METHOD a readCustomDataFromTag (Lib;)V ARG 1 tag METHOD a addScoreboardTag (Ljava/lang/String;)Z METHOD a setUuid (Ljava/util/UUID;)V METHOD a onTrackedDataSet (Lqh;)V ARG 1 data METHOD a playSound (Lyi;FF)V ARG 1 sound ARG 2 volume METHOD a isInFluid (Lza;)Z METHOD a isInFluid (Lza;Z)Z ARG 2 requireLoadedChunk METHOD a toListTag ([D)Lii; METHOD a toListTag ([F)Lii; METHOD aA spawnSprintingParticles ()V METHOD aB isTouchingLava ()Z METHOD aC getLightmapCoordinates ()I METHOD aD getBrightnessAtEyes ()F METHOD aE scheduleVelocityUpdate ()V METHOD aF doesCollide ()Z METHOD aG isPushable ()Z METHOD aH shouldSetPositionOnLoad ()Z METHOD aI getSavedEntityId ()Ljava/lang/String; METHOD aJ isAlive ()Z METHOD aK isInsideWall ()Z METHOD aL updateRiding ()V METHOD aM getHeightOffset ()D METHOD aN getMountedHeightOffset ()D METHOD aP removeAllPassengers ()V METHOD aQ getBoundingBoxMarginForTargeting ()F METHOD aS getRotationClient ()Lcrk; METHOD aT getRotationVecClient ()Lcrl; METHOD aV getDefaultPortalCooldown ()I METHOD aX getItemsHand ()Ljava/lang/Iterable; METHOD aY getArmorItems ()Ljava/lang/Iterable; METHOD aZ getItemsEquipped ()Ljava/lang/Iterable; METHOD a_ equip (ILbbr;)Z ARG 1 slot ARG 2 item METHOD aa baseTick ()V METHOD ab getMaxPortalTime ()I METHOD ac setOnFireFromLava ()V METHOD ad extinguish ()V METHOD ae destroy ()V METHOD ag moveToBoundingBoxCenter ()V METHOD ah getSwimSound ()Lyi; METHOD ai getSplashSound ()Lyi; METHOD aj getHighSpeedSplashSound ()Lyi; METHOD ak checkBlockCollision ()V METHOD am isSilent ()Z METHOD an isUnaffectedByGravity ()Z METHOD ao canClimb ()Z METHOD aq isFireImmune ()Z METHOD ar isInsideWater ()Z METHOD as isInsideWaterOrRain ()Z METHOD at isTouchingWater ()Z METHOD au isInsideWaterOrBubbleColumn ()Z METHOD av isInWater ()Z METHOD aw updateSwimming ()V METHOD ay onSwimmingStart ()V METHOD az attemptSprintingParticles ()V METHOD b setRenderDistanceMultiplier (D)V ARG 0 value METHOD b setPositionAndAngles (DDDFF)V ARG 1 x ARG 3 y ARG 5 z ARG 7 yaw ARG 8 pitch METHOD b handleFallDamage (FF)V ARG 1 fallDistance ARG 2 damageMultiplier METHOD b setFlag (IZ)V ARG 1 index METHOD b isInvulnerableTo (Lahj;)Z METHOD b setPose (Lait;)V METHOD b onPlayerCollision (Lavo;)V METHOD b interact (Lavo;Lagu;)Z ARG 1 player METHOD b doesNotCollide (Lcrg;)Z ARG 1 box METHOD b squaredHorizontalLength (Lcrl;)D METHOD b writeCustomDataToTag (Lib;)V ARG 1 tag METHOD b removeScoreboardTag (Ljava/lang/String;)Z METHOD b setCustomName (Ljm;)V METHOD b onStartedTrackingBy (Lvg;)V METHOD b isInsideFluid (Lza;)Z METHOD bA getEntityName ()Ljava/lang/String; METHOD bB canFly ()Z METHOD bC getRenderDistanceMultiplier ()D METHOD bD isCustomNameVisible ()Z METHOD bE shouldRenderName ()Z METHOD bF getHorizontalFacing ()Lfa; METHOD bG getMovementDirection ()Lfa; METHOD bH getComponentHoverEvent ()Ljp; METHOD bI getBoundingBox ()Lcrg; METHOD bJ getVisibilityBoundingBox ()Lcrg; METHOD bK getStandingEyeHeight ()F METHOD bL getBlockPos ()Lev; METHOD bM getPosVector ()Lcrl; METHOD bN getEntityWorld ()Lbgx; METHOD bO getServer ()Lnet/minecraft/server/MinecraftServer; METHOD bP isImmuneToExplosion ()Z METHOD bS getPrimaryPassenger ()Laia; METHOD bT getPassengerList ()Ljava/util/List; METHOD bU getPassengersDeep ()Ljava/util/Collection; METHOD bW getTopmostRiddenEntity ()Laia; METHOD bX isLogicalSideForUpdatingMovement ()Z METHOD bY getRiddenEntity ()Laia; METHOD bZ getSoundCategory ()Lyk; METHOD ba isOnFire ()Z METHOD bb hasVehicle ()Z METHOD bc hasPassengers ()Z METHOD bd canBeRiddenInWater ()Z METHOD be isSneaking ()Z METHOD bg isSprinting ()Z METHOD bh isSwimming ()Z METHOD bj isGlowing ()Z METHOD bk isInvisible ()Z METHOD bl getScoreboardTeam ()Lcsn; METHOD bm getMaxBreath ()I METHOD bn getBreath ()I METHOD bo getHeadYaw ()F METHOD bq isInvulnerable ()Z METHOD br canUsePortals ()Z METHOD bs getSafeFallDistance ()I METHOD bw canAvoidTraps ()Z METHOD bx doesRenderOnFire ()Z METHOD by getUuid ()Ljava/util/UUID; METHOD bz getUuidAsString ()Ljava/lang/String; METHOD c setPosition (DDD)V ARG 1 x ARG 3 y ARG 5 z METHOD c getVectorFromRotation (FF)Lcrl; ARG 1 pitch ARG 2 yaw METHOD c canSeePlayer (Lavo;)Z METHOD c squaredDistanceTo (Lcrl;)D METHOD c setInPortal (Lev;)V METHOD c saveSelfToTag (Lib;)Z METHOD c onStoppedTrackingBy (Lvg;)V METHOD c setSilent (Z)V METHOD cb getCommandSource ()Lcd; METHOD cd getWidth ()F METHOD ce getHeight ()F METHOD cf getPos ()Lcrl; METHOD cg getVelocity ()Lcrl; METHOD d doesNotCollide (DDD)Z ARG 1 offsetX ARG 3 offsetY ARG 5 offsetZ METHOD d playSwimSound (F)V ARG 1 volume METHOD d getEyeHeight (Lait;)F ARG 1 pose METHOD d setVelocity (Lcrl;)V METHOD d saveToTag (Lib;)Z METHOD d setUnaffectedByGravity (Z)V METHOD e squaredDistanceTo (DDD)D ARG 1 x METHOD e setEntityId (I)V METHOD e toTag (Lib;)Lib; METHOD e setSneaking (Z)V METHOD equals (Ljava/lang/Object;)Z ARG 1 o METHOD f addVelocity (DDD)V ARG 1 deltaX ARG 3 deltaY ARG 5 deltaZ METHOD f getRotationVec (F)Lcrl; ARG 1 tickDelta METHOD f setOnFireFor (I)V METHOD f fromTag (Lib;)V METHOD f setSprinting (Z)V METHOD g shouldRenderFrom (DDD)Z ARG 1 x ARG 3 y ARG 5 z METHOD g getPitch (F)F ARG 1 tickDelta METHOD g burn (I)V METHOD g distanceTo (Laia;)F METHOD g setSwimming (Z)V ARG 1 swimming METHOD h tick ()V METHOD h setVelocityClient (DDD)V ARG 1 x ARG 3 y ARG 5 z METHOD h getYaw (F)F ARG 1 tickDelta METHOD h getFlag (I)Z METHOD h squaredDistanceTo (Laia;)D METHOD h setGlowing (Z)V METHOD i pushOutOfBlocks (DDD)V ARG 1 x ARG 3 y ARG 5 z METHOD i setBreath (I)V METHOD i pushAwayFrom (Laia;)V METHOD i setInvisible (Z)V METHOD j stopRiding ()V METHOD j setVelocity (DDD)V METHOD j getCameraPosVec (F)Lcrl; ARG 1 tickDelta METHOD j allowsPermissionLevel (I)Z METHOD k isBeingRainedOn ()Z METHOD k setHeadYaw (F)V ARG 1 headYaw METHOD l isInsideBubbleColumn ()Z METHOD l setYaw (F)V METHOD l setInvulnerable (Z)V METHOD m startRiding (Laia;)Z METHOD m setCustomNameVisible (Z)V METHOD n canStartRiding (Laia;)Z METHOD o addPassenger (Laia;)V METHOD p removePassenger (Laia;)V METHOD q canAddPassenger (Laia;)Z METHOD r isTeammate (Laia;)Z METHOD s isPartOf (Laia;)Z METHOD t isSpectator ()Z METHOD u setPositionAndAngles (Laia;)V METHOD u_ initDataTracker ()V METHOD w hasPassenger (Laia;)Z METHOD x isConnectedThroughVehicle (Laia;)Z ARG 1 entity METHOD x_ refreshSize ()V METHOD y getPermissionLevel ()I METHOD y_ getPistonBehavior ()Lckv;